Different Approaches to Counselling in Recovery
Every person requires a unique approach in counselling. Treatment methods exist for a diverse range of individual requirements and personal preferences. The recovery process succeeds through following these techniques:
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y (CBT)
The clinical method of CBT possesses broad usage in helping patients recognize their destructive thoughts along with their encouraging replacement and behavioral modifications. The treatment method works best when it helps patients who struggle with addiction combined with depression or anxiety issues. Through exploration of untruthful beliefs and adoption of better coping practices people can create better responses to manage their situations.
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T)
DBT therapy produces valuable results for people who need assistance in emotional control and experience self-injury behavior or are diagnosed with borderline personality disorder. The therapy brings together elements of behavior modification and mindfulness practices to help patients develop emotional control skills thus strengthening their relationships with others.
Trauma-Informed Therapy
The treatment of trauma incorporates a therapeutic approach which recognizes previous traumatic events of the patient. This approach helps a client feel safe, accepted while they are talking about their painful memories where the therapist makes the setting protected.
Motivational Interviewing
MI provides a client-centered method which helps people become more motivated for change. The approach works best for people going through addiction problems. Together with their clients counselors create an environment for connected dialogue which enables clients to build their recovery dedication while discovering their personal reasons for change.
Group Therapy
Participants in group therapy develop social relations while receiving beneficial support from people who share their encounter challenges. People find great power and validation through sharing their experiences with others who have similar difficulties. The process helps individuals gain knowledge from others in their group as well as build relationships with peers who share their experiences.
Holistic Therapy
Holistic therapy accepts alternative methods which combine yoga with meditation along with art therapy. These intervention methods together with regular counseling sessions benefit patients by improving their entire health condition. Organized creative or physical activities act as supportive elements in the path toward recovery according to numerous patients.
Overcoming Barriers to Seeking Counselling
The advantages of counselling do not convince numerous people to obtain counselling support because they face different obstacles in their way. Common obstacles include:
Stigma and Misconceptions
People who experience mental health and addiction problems usually face additional social judgment from others. People who seek assistance sometimes encounter discrimination through others labeling them as weak. The public requires education about mental health importance together with therapy normalization to eliminate existing misconceptions.
Financial Constraints
Many potential clients avoid counselling because its prices are prohibitive. The limited budget can be addressed through community programs along with non-profit organizations and online therapy platforms which provide free or reduced-cost services.
Accessibility
The demand for professional help becomes difficult for people who reside in distant locations. Several teletherapy and online counselling services now help people who need support but have no access to traditional in-person therapy services.
Fear of Vulnerability
Displaying the problems we face in our lives demands considerable bravery. Most people hesitate to face their intense emotions because they also avoid revisiting their previous difficult experiences. Experienced therapists take patients through this process while showing care and maintaining an appropriate pace that matches their comfort level.
Lack of Awareness
A number of people fail to identify proper places to begin their search for counseling assistance. Making known all recovery resources jointly with therapy options and counseling advantages will produce higher attendance numbers from individuals seeking help.
